在IDEA 的 Terminal 中 使用 “git log” 查看记录,发现显示的是乱码:
大家可以直接看:《二、实际使用另一种方法》
一、暂时找到的办法:
1.使用的命令“set LESSCHARSET=utf-8”,重新打开一个terminal ,再次查看记录就是正常中文了。
这种办法每次都得输入一次命令才起作用。
2.使用“git --no-pager log” ,也是一个临时的解决办法。
在经过大量百度之后,并没有解决问题,最后俺灵光一闪,想出了解决方案:
3.将第一个方案的命令加到 “环境变量” 里边,问题解决,欧耶!
===================================================================================
二、实际使用另一种方法:
1.在IDEA中“File”——》“Settings”——》“Tools”——》“Terminal”——》“Shell path”,点击右边的文件夹,换成自己安装Git目录下边的“bash.exe” 文件,该文件在“bin”目录中。
2.在Git安装目录下,找到“etc”文件夹,里边有个名为“bash.bashrc” 的文件,用文本编辑器打开,在末尾添加下面的代码:
export LANG="zh_CN.UTF-8"
export LC_ALL="zh_CN.UTF-8"
3.重新打开IDEA,就不会看到乱码了。